SPP Polymers' shares debuted on the NSE SME platform with a 6.78% premium, listing at Rs 63 against an issue price of Rs 59. The IPO saw a strong investor response, being subscribed over 40 times. The company plans to use the proceeds for loan repayment, working capital, and general corporate purposes.
